'  PURPOSE: convert numbers into words for check printing, etc.
'   PARAMS: Number# incoming - any valid number
'  RETURNS: the number in text
'           eg: fValue2Words$ ( 100.10 ) returns
'              "ONE HUNDRED DOLLARS AND 10 CENTS"
'   NOTE: the function is not set-up to handle negative numbers as they
'          would not appear on a check
' -------------------------------------------------------------------------

CLS
PRINT fValue2Words(32421009.34)
PRINT
PRINT fValue2Words(900132924462342.00)
PRINT
PRINT fValue2Words(123.10)

DECLARE FUNCTION fValue2Words (BYVAL Number AS DOUBLE) AS STRING

FUNCTION fValue2Words ( BYVAL Number AS DOUBLE ) AS STRING

  DIM Cma     AS LOCAL  STRING
  DIM I       AS LOCAL  INTEGER
  DIM Last    AS LOCAL  INTEGER
  DIM Nbr     AS LOCAL  STRING
  DIM Plc     AS LOCAL  INTEGER
  DIM Temp    AS LOCAL  STRING
  DIM V       AS LOCAL  INTEGER
  DIM Wrd(35) AS STATIC STRING

  IF LEN(Wrd(1)) = 0 THEN
    RESTORE Value2WordsData
    FOR I = 0 TO 35
      READ Wrd(I)
    NEXT
  END IF

  Nbr  = USING$("###############,.##",Number)             ' a number to work with
  Cma  = MID$(pbvUsingChrs,3,1)                           ' thou sep char
  Last = TALLY( Nbr, Cma ) + 1                            ' # of pieces
  Plc  = 1                                                '
  '-------------------------------------------------------'
  DO                                                      ' from left to right
    DECR Last                                             '
    V   = VAL( EXTRACT$(MID$(Nbr,Plc), Cma) )             ' get the 000
    Plc = INSTR(Plc,Nbr,Cma) + 1                          '
    IF V = 0 THEN ITERATE                                 ' nada!
    IF V > 99 THEN                                        ' hundreds position
      I = ( V  \  100 )                                   '   # of hundreds
      V = ( V MOD 100 )                                   '   > 100
      Temp = Temp & Wrd(I) & Wrd(33)                      '   add words
    END IF                                                '
    IF ( V > 10 ) AND ( V < 20 ) THEN                     ' teens
        Temp = Temp & Wrd(V)                              '   add words
      ELSEIF V > 0 THEN                                   ' anything left?
        IF V > 9 THEN                                     ' tens
          I = ( V  \  10 )                                '   # of tens - 1
          V = ( V MOD 10 )                                '   strip tens
          Temp = Temp & Wrd(I+19)                         '   add words
        END IF                                            '
        IF V > 0 THEN Temp = Temp & Wrd(V)                ' ones
    END IF                                                '
    IF Last > 0 THEN Temp = Temp & Wrd(Last+28)           ' thousands/mills/etc
  LOOP UNTIL Last = 0                                     '
  '-------------------------------------------------------'
  IF LEN(Temp) = 0 THEN Temp = Wrd(0)                     ' no ones!
  Temp = Temp & Wrd(34) & RIGHT$(Nbr,2) & Wrd(35)         ' add decimals
  '-------------------------------------------------------'-----------------------
  FUNCTION = Temp                                         ' RETURN STRING
                                                          '-----------------------
  Value2WordsData:                                        '
  DATA "00 "                                              ' "NO " is alternate
  DATA "ONE ", "TWO ", "THREE ", "FOUR ", "FIVE ", "SIX " '
  DATA "SEVEN ", "EIGHT ", "NINE ", "", "ELEVEN "         '
  DATA "TWELVE ", "THIRTEEN ", "FOURTEEN ", "FIFTEEN "    '
  DATA "SIXTEEN ", "SEVENTEEN ", "EIGHTEEN ", "NINETEEN " '
  DATA "TEN ", "TWENTY ", "THIRTY ", "FORTY ", "FIFTY "   '
  DATA "SIXTY ", "SEVENTY ", "EIGHTY ", "NINETY "         '
  DATA "THOUSAND ", "MILLION ", "BILLION ", "TRILLION "   '
  DATA "HUNDRED ", "DOLLARS AND ", " CENTS"               '

END FUNCTION
